Probably would have been more embarassing - well maybe not.
Mr and Mrs Starcrafter65 took the Bare Naked Lady out on Lake Erie last week - so it was just us two launching. We were launching at Erie Basin Marina - Buffalo - so pretty crowded.
Normally launching is about as easy as pie - and the launch is nice and steep
So I back the boat up - now bear in mind I have rollers not bunks - we unhook the back tie downs - and I have always done this - I unhook the front safety chain and the front winch strap.
Now - typically back the boat up - tap the brakes - and we are floating.
So I am backing the boat up and the rollers appear to be working very well - so well the boat starts rolling off the trailer before I am in the water. Now - of course I can't hit the brakes because that will be instant :facepalm: - so I just commit and aggressively back up.
Thankfully - I got to the water in time. There were lots of people around - I just acted like - "What's the big deal?"
Phew
